OPSWAT | Software Engineer (C++/ C#)

Vietnam

Full-time

04/12 — 18/12/2025

Job Description

To apply for this job, you need to complete both steps below:
STEP 1:
Please click the link to submit your application directly to the company: 

Software Engineer (C++/ C#) - OPSWAT

Your application will only be received by Recruiter if submitted via above link. 

STEP 2:
Kindly scroll to the bottom of this page and complete the short VinUni Tracking Form.

Filling out this form alone does not count as applying. Kindly remind this form is not part of the company’s application process. It only helps Careers, Alumni, Industry and Development (CAID) Department discover more opportunities and follow up in case of system issues.

 

What You Will Be Doing 

  • Understand and align with the overall product vision and goals.

  • Design, implement, and test OPSWAT MetaDefender products built on C++ and C# (.NET Core) for both Windows and Linux environments.

  • Build and develop an automation test framework using Python to ensure product quality and reliability.

  • Interact with data, including files, documents, images, etc., at both binary and structural levels.

  • Enrich features for existing software modules (back-end engines) which process millions of files daily, ensuring high performance and scalability.

  • Demonstrate strong ownership and commitment to meeting project timelines

What We Need from You 

  • Bachelor's or higher degree in Computer Science or related fields.

  • Strong knowledge of Computer Science fundamentals, including data structures and algorithms, operating systems, and computer systems.

  • Object-Oriented mindset, with expertise in OOP (Object-Oriented Programming) and OOD (Object-Oriented Design).

  • Logical thinking, critical thinking, and problem-solving skills.

  • Proficiency in English, particularly in reading and writing.

  • Passion in using AI to increase efficiency.

It Would be Nice if You Had 

  • Programming experience with languages such as C++, C# or Python.

  • Basic knowledge of machine learning.

  • Experience with REST API and Web.

  • Familiarity with Docker, CD/CI pipelines, Git, TeamCity, Jira, and Confluence

Application form

Full Name *
Email Address *
College  *
VinUni Email  *
Your Resume *
To attach your Resume, click here to upload from your Computer.
Security code *

Submit